Models can be helpful in scientific investigations because they simplify complex systems, allowing researchers to visualize and understand intricate processes. They enable predictions about outcomes based on different variables and scenarios, making it easier to test hypotheses. Additionally, models facilitate communication of ideas and findings, helping to bridge gaps between theoretical concepts and practical applications.

Data from a scientific experiment are analyzed to draw conclusions about the hypothesis being tested. Researchers use statistical methods to interpret the results, determine their significance, and assess whether the hypothesis is supported or refuted. The findings are often shared through publications, contributing to the broader scientific knowledge and informing future research. Additionally, data can be used to develop practical applications, influence policy decisions, or address real-world problems.

Most scientific investigations are carried out to explore, understand, and explain natural phenomena. They aim to test hypotheses and gather evidence that can lead to new discoveries or validate existing theories. Additionally, scientific research helps address practical problems and informs decision-making in various fields, from medicine to environmental science. Ultimately, these investigations contribute to the advancement of knowledge and improve our understanding of the world.
Earth scientists often conduct investigations instead of controlled experiments because they are studying natural processes that are complex and difficult to replicate in a controlled setting. The Earth's dynamic and interconnected systems are influenced by various factors that are constantly changing, making it more practical to observe and analyze real-world phenomena in their natural context.
